Several factors to consider here. What was the final blow to where your original engine finally died? Sounds like you love this car so why not rebuild the engine (or find a speed shop somewhere with crate engines ready to install). Has this Vibe been subjected to nasty corrosive winters to where rust is an issue? If not then I say put a couple thousand back into this Vibe and keep it going for another few hundred thousand miles.
